Aggregate of recycled concrete screening plant
Technical field
The present invention relates to screening plant, more particularly to a kind of Aggregate of recycled concrete screening plant.
Background technology
Regeneration concrete be using discarded concrete through broken processing after, be made regenerated coarse aggregate and fine aggregate, partly or All instead of natural coarse aggregate and fine aggregate after, the concrete being formulated, after crushing, the aggregate for obtaining is discarded concrete Regeneration aggregate, these aggregates are sieved using preceding needs, and such as notification number is disclosed for the Chinese patent of CN203791183U A kind of Aggregate of recycled concrete oscillatory type screening plant for being easy to discharging, including sieve nest, feeding device, support housing, motor-vibro screen Seat, described feeding device is located at whole screening plant top, and feeding device bottom is connected with sieve nest, feeding device, sieve nest one Side is connected with support housing, and the outer frame bottom spring of sieve nest, support is connected with motor-vibro screen seat, and described sieve nest includes 8 sieves, Order of the described sieve according to sieve diameter from big to small is from top to bottom arranged, and described motor-vibro screen seat refers to built-in motor Sieve seat, this screening plant can use in modification regeneration aggregate production process, regeneration aggregate is formed good level and match somebody with somebody, Modification regeneration concrete pore rate is reduced, modification regeneration concrete strength, impervious and durability is improved.
But the equipment can have aggregates in use to be stuck on the sieve aperture on sieve nest, causes to be difficult to clear up, And can so influence the screening efficiency of follow-up aggregate.

Specific embodiment
The present invention is described in further detail below in conjunction with accompanying drawing.
This specific embodiment is only explanation of the invention, and it is not limitation of the present invention, people in the art Member can make the modification without creative contribution to the present embodiment as needed after this specification is read, but as long as at this All protected by Patent Law in the right of invention.
Embodiment 1:A kind of Aggregate of recycled concrete screening plant, as depicted in figs. 1 and 2, including support frame 1 and body, The body includes housing 2 and is rotatably connected to sieve nest 3 housing 2 is tilted, and is provided with the one end of housing 2 and connects with sieve nest 3 Logical feed hopper 15, is evenly distributed with sieve aperture 31 on the sieve nest 3, and the driving machine for driving it to rotate is provided with sieve nest 3 Structure, the drive mechanism is motor 4 and decelerator, and wherein housing 2 includes top shell 21 and drain pan 22, and is opened up in the upper bottom portion of drain pan 22 There is drain spout 221, so that in the sieve nest 3 for entering into rotation after aggregate is poured into from feed hopper 15, the less aggregate of particle can Dropped from sieve aperture 31 and spilt from drain spout 221, and the larger aggregate of particle is rolled to the lowest part of sieve nest 3 and carries out under gravity Collect, so as to realize the screening to aggregate, wherein top shell 21 includes 3 points of shells 211 of split, and point side of shell 211 is hinged on bottom On shell 22, and observation window 10 is provided with each point of shell 211, consequently facilitating the situation in the housing 2 of staff, therefore It was observed that when the sieve nest 3 of one of part interior goes wrong, point shell 211 accordingly need to be only opened, without by entirely Top shell 21 is opened, and is operated more laborsaving.
As shown in figure 3, opening top shell 21 for convenience, therefore handle 11, handle are rotatably connected on point shell 211 at middle part Fixed strip 12 is fixed with 11, the two ends of fixed strip 12 are hinged with inserted link 13, are offered for inserted link 13 on point shell 211 of both sides The jack 14 of grafting, can realize the linkage and separation between point shell 211, so as to be adjusted according to actual needs, when needing When opening whole top shell 21, i.e. realization links so that inserted link 13 is plugged in the jack 14 of point shell 211 only need to rotate handle 11, The opening of whole top shell 21 is capable of achieving when now stirring point shell 211, and when only needing to open one of them point of shell 211, is rotated Handle 11 causes that inserted link 13 is removed from jack 14, and now each point of shell 211 is in released state, opens in requisition for dividing for opening Shell 211, operates more laborsaving.
As shown in Fig. 2 and Fig. 4-Fig. 6, sieve aperture 31 is connected to due to easily occurring some aggregates during specifically used It is interior, cause the screening efficiency and effect of follow-up aggregate, and the aggregate cleaning that these are blocked gets up cumbersome, therefore on roller Side is provided with the mounting bracket 6 being fixed on support frame 1, and axially disposed mounting bar 5 is provided with mounting bracket 6, and It is provided with push rod 51 corresponding with sieve aperture 31 on mounting bar 5, the end of push rod 51 is fixed with aperture and pushes the ball 52 more than sieve aperture 31, 52 it is close to the first spring 53 of sieve aperture 31 pushing the ball to be provided with to push the ball between 52 and mounting bar 5 simultaneously, therefore has portion running into When being connected with aggregate in sub-sieve hole 31,52 meetings of being pushed the ball during sieve nest 3 is rotated constantly are being absorbed in each sieve aperture 31, will The aggregate being stuck in sieve aperture 31 is pushed into sieve nest 3, so that very easily realize clearing up the aggregate being stuck in sieve aperture 31, Keep sieve nest 3 to be in good screening state, because 52 surfaces of pushing the ball are cambered surfaces during this, therefore pushed the ball during the rotation of sieve nest 3 52 easily remove sieve aperture 31, and the first spring 53 is compressed, and then can be pushed into another sieve aperture by the restoring force of the first spring 53 In 31, the situation of clamping stagnation is less prone to;Due to 52 sinking into easily to occur in sieve aperture 31 always if pushed the ball in the usually course of work The situation of abrasion, therefore the chute 61 slided for mounting bar 5 is provided with mounting bracket 6, drive installation bar is provided with mounting bracket 6 5 slide the actuators for realizing lifting in the chute 61, and the actuator includes being rotatably connected on chute 61 and through the spiral shell of mounting bar 5 Bar 7, the screw rod 7 is threaded on mounting bar 5, so that event is in 3 normal work of sieve nest, can be by actuator drive installation Bar 5 is moved to push the ball and 52 leaves sieve aperture 31, and now sieve nest 3 is rotated and has more fluency, while 52 Long Term Contacts that also avoid pushing the ball are produced The situation of abrasion, run into need cleaning be stuck in the aggregate in sieve aperture 31 when, then drive installation bar 5 to push the ball 52 be located at sieve aperture 31 Interior, when now sieve nest 3 is rotated, the aggregate being stuck in sieve aperture 31 can be pushed the ball 52 roof falls.
The abutting block 54 abutted with it, the first spring 53 are threaded with the first spring 53 of correspondence of mounting bar 5 in addition One end is connected on abutting block 54, and the other end is connected on push rod 51, therefore when the elastic force for needing regulation to push the ball 52 is run into, is only needed Rotate and abut block 54 and be capable of achieving, it is simple to operate, so as to adjust 52 suitable elastic force of pushing the ball according to actual needs, more it is applicable Property;In order to increase the stability of the deformation of the first spring 53, it is convexly equipped with block 54 is abutted convex with what the inner ring of the first spring 53 coordinated Post 55, and the shrinkage pool 56 coordinated with projection 55 is offered on push rod 51, shrinkage pool 56 can give the stroke of the movement of projection 55, from And by the supporting role of projection 55 so that the deformation that the first spring 53 can be stablized vertically.
Wherein to push the ball and offer the screwed hole 57 being threadedly coupled with push rod 51 on 52, thus realize pushing the ball 52 it is detachable more Change, therefore when abrasion occur after running into 52 long-term uses of pushing the ball and being difficult to be continuing with, need to will only push the ball and 52 remove and changed i.e. Can, at the same for different pore size sieve aperture 31 when, it is also possible to that changes different-diameter pushes the ball 52 up, more applicability.
Embodiment 2:A kind of Aggregate of recycled concrete screening plant, as shown in Figure 7 and Figure 8, it exists with the difference of embodiment 1 In the difference of actuator, actuator includes being located in chute 61 and being connected to the stud 8 of mounting bar 5, and mounting bar 5 is away from stud Second spring 9 is provided between 8 one end and the inwall of chute 61, so only stud 8 need to be rotated, installation is promoted by stud 8 The adjustment position of bar 5, when stud 8 is rotated into interior shifting, second spring 9 is compressed, and when upset stud 8 is retreated, mounting bar 5 can be the Recover in the presence of two springs 9, simple structure, the stud 8 of same threaded connection equally has the non-return effect of axial direction so that peace The regulation of dress bar 5 position has more stability.
